Why Size Matters: Fewer joints mean less water infiltration, reduced maintenance, and a cleaner, more modern look. Traditional 600x600mm tiles might require dozens of seams per wall—each a potential weak point. With COLORIA's big slabs, that number drops dramatically, turning a patchwork wall into a smooth, cohesive statement.

In an era where every decision counts for the planet, COLORIA's MCM materials are a breath of fresh air. Modified cementitious materials use industrial byproducts—like fly ash and slag—as key ingredients, reducing the need for virgin resources. The production process skips the high-temperature firing of traditional ceramics, slashing carbon emissions. And because these panels are lightweight, they reduce the structural load of buildings, meaning less steel and concrete are needed in the foundation—another win for sustainability.
